As most of you know the Pioneer A05 writer doesn't work correctly when using PrimoDVD software, as the program doesn't reconize the drive even with the latest PXengine update, until see below:
However, i've just recently upgraded from an A04 to a A05, as i got the A05 writer for £50 from a friend :). Anyway, i had updated my PrimoDVD and RecordnowMax with the latest PXengine update i.e (390) before installing the A05. To my amazement PrimoDVD reconized the A05 straight away and i've sucessfully burned 5 PS2 games at 4X. This has really confused me, as a lot of people who use this forum don't agree using Primo with the A05, as it does not work properly. I know because my friend has had the A05 from Day 1 and basically he had problems with Primo not seeing the drive. This is not a joke or a wind up, etc. As i really have PrimoDVD working with the A05. Could it be the new PXengine that's fixed the problem. What do you think 'BG'?
